How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 06070?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 06070 Studio Apartments | $2,056 | $1,675 | $3,300 |
| 06070 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,397 | $1,350 | $3,510 |
| 06070 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,135 | $1,275 | $5,822 |
| 06070 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,795 | $2,850 | $4,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 06070 ZIP Code
How much are Studio apartments in 06070?
There are currently 9 Studio Apartments in 06070 with rent ranges from $1,675 to $3,300 with an average price of $2,056.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om 06070 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 06070 ranges from $1,350 to $3,510 with an average monthly rent of $2,397.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 06070 c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 06070 range from $1,275 to $5,822.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,135.
How expensive are 06070 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 7 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 06070 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,850 to $4,500 - averaging $3,795 for the location.
